A Tourmaline Duck Carving,
Idar-Oberstein, Germany,
composed of an intense purplish red and highly transparent rubellite tourmaline carving depicting a realistic duck in flight, the outstretched wings with individually detailed feathers, the body finely etched, the eyes inset with round brilliant cut diamonds, the beak of golden citrine, the legs of gold vermeil, mounted on a freeform rock crystal slab of exceptional clarity.
16.50 x 14.60 cm.
Estimate $ 5,000-7,000
